Terraform AWS Cloudfront-S3-CDN:打造高性能的静态资源分发平台

Terraform AWS Cloudfront-S3-CDN:打造高性能的静态资源分发平台

terraform-aws-cloudfront-s3-cdnTerraform module to easily provision CloudFront CDN backed by an S3 origin项目地址:https://gitcode.com/gh_mirrors/te/terraform-aws-cloudfront-s3-cdn

在这个高度数字化的时代,快速可靠的网络体验是用户的首要需求。通过Terraform AWS Cloudfront-S3-CDN开源项目,您可以轻松构建一个高效能的内容分发网络(CDN),优化静态资产的全球访问速度。该项目充分利用了Amazon Web Services(AWS)的CloudFront和S3服务,为您提供了简单易用且可扩展的解决方案。

项目简介

Terraform AWS Cloudfront-S3-CDN是一个Terraform模块,用于在AWS上创建CloudFront CDN并配置其与S3存储桶作为源的连接。该模块可以自动化创建整个CDN基础设施,包括DNS记录,以及对不同用户角色的精细权限管理。

技术解析

  1. CloudFront CDN: 提供低延迟、高数据传输速率的服务,将内容缓存到世界各地的边缘位置,确保用户从最近的服务器获取内容。
  2. S3 存储桶: AWS的简单存储服务,经济实惠且安全地存储您的静态资产,如HTML、CSS、JavaScript文件等。
  3. Terraform: 它是一种强大的基础设施即代码(IAC)工具,允许您以声明性方式管理基础设施,并将其版本化和集成到CI/CD流程中。
  4. IAM 角色与权限管理: 模块支持为不同的AWS IAM角色分配特定的前缀访问权限,确保安全性。

应用场景

  • 高流量的网站或应用,需要在全球范围内提供快速加载的静态资源。
  • 大型媒体上传和流式传输服务,要求高效的视频和音频传输。
  • 需要保护静态资源访问的安全性,例如限制某些用户只能访问特定目录下的内容。

项目特点

  1. 灵活配置: 支持自定义别名(aliases)和DNS记录,轻松将CDN集成到现有域名系统。
  2. 权限控制: 可按角色设置不同级别的访问权限,例如仅允许某些用户上传特定目录的文件。
  3. 故障切换: 可配置多个S3源,实现自动故障切换,增加服务的可用性和稳定性。
  4. 自动化部署: 使用Terraform进行一键部署,简化管理和维护工作。
  5. 安全合规: 符合多种安全标准和最佳实践,包括CIS基准、NIST 800-53等。

借助Terraform AWS Cloudfront-S3-Cdn,您可以专注于开发精彩的内容,而无需担心性能和安全性问题。无论是初创公司还是大型企业,这个开源项目都是构建高效CDN的理想选择。立即加入我们的社区,分享您的经验和见解,共同提升全球用户体验。

terraform-aws-cloudfront-s3-cdnTerraform module to easily provision CloudFront CDN backed by an S3 origin项目地址:https://gitcode.com/gh_mirrors/te/terraform-aws-cloudfront-s3-cdn

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

芮奕滢Kirby

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值